Nexus Mods, a popular modding site, finds itself at the center of a heated debate after removing over 500 user-submitted modifications for the game Marvel Rivals within a single month. The controversy ignited when mods replacing Captain America's head with images of Joe Biden and Donald Trump were taken down.

Nexus Mods' owner, TheDarkOne, addressed the situation on Reddit, clarifying that both the Biden and Trump mods were removed simultaneously to prevent accusations of partisan favoritism. TheDarkOne stated, "We removed the Biden mod on the same day as the Trump mod to avoid bias. But for some reason YouTube bloggers are silent about it."

However, this action sparked a wave of online harassment. TheDarkOne reported receiving numerous death threats and hateful messages, stating, "Today we receive death threats, are called pedophiles and subjected to all sorts of insults simply because someone decided to inflame this issue."

This isn't the first time Nexus Mods has faced backlash over mod removals. A similar incident occurred in 2022 when a Spider-Man Remastered mod that replaced rainbow flags with American flags was removed. At the time, the site's administration publicly affirmed its commitment to inclusivity and its policy of removing content deemed discriminatory.

TheDarkOne concluded by stating, "We're not going to waste our time on people who think this is cause for uproar." The situation highlights the ongoing tension between freedom of expression and platform moderation within online gaming communities.
